JUMC Green Team Garden
Under the guidance of Nancy White, “Gardner Extraordinaire” from Rexford, we have designed, planted and are growing produce to be supplied to the Helping Hands Food Pantry. Thanks to the youth (above) for helping with the planting.
The Garden is symbolic of the Jonesville United Methodist Church’s commitment to care for the needy in our community and beyond. It is also reflective of our caring for creation through the protection and preservation of the sacredness of the earth.
The basic layout is in the shape of a cross following the logo pattern developed by Claire Walling. The arms of the cross are raised beds (4x8) and the center is an “at grade” garden. We have attempted to simulate the green spirit flame with vine crops…Watch the flame grow!
The garden has used a “no-till” “weedless” gardening approach employing organic approaches.
